2. Challenges Of Recycling Solar Panels
It is commonly accepted that reusing photovoltaic panels has several environmental benefits, nevertheless, it is also true that the procedure isn't without its challenges. However exactly what are these obstacles? Let's explore additionally.
One of the most significant problems with reusing photovoltaic panels is the intricacy of the job itself. It can be tough to break down the various components, such as glass and metal, to be reused separately. Additionally, photovoltaic panel suppliers usually have a mix of materials utilized in their items which makes sorting them even more difficult. Moreover, there are security and health and wellness dangers entailed with handling busted glass or inhaling fumes from thawing parts.
One more essential challenge related to recycling photovoltaic panels is price. Numerous nations do not have sufficient framework or sources to properly recycle these items which brings about higher expenses for businesses trying to do so. Additionally, as a result of the specific nature of reusing photovoltaic panels, this can create a financial concern on companies attempting to remain compliant with guidelines. Ultimately, these expenses could be given to customers making it difficult for them to pay for renewable resource sources.

3. Techniques For Reusing Solar Panels
As the world pursues a more sustainable future, reusing photovoltaic panels is a significantly prominent task. Amidst this expanding interest, nonetheless, we must take into consideration the techniques that remain in place to make it possible.
To start with, several companies have actually applied a 'take-back' system wherein old or broken solar panels can be collected and sent to their corresponding factories for reusing. By doing this, the products are able to be reused in the building of brand-new products. Additionally, some districts have also begun providing incentives for people wishing to reuse their photovoltaic panels; this might vary from tax obligation breaks to cost-free delivery prices.
In addition, technology has ended up being progressively sophisticated when it involves recycling photovoltaic panels-- with specialist equipments with the ability of separating out all the different components within them. For instance, by utilizing AI-powered robotic arms, these devices can draw out helpful materials such as copper and aluminium while likewise dealing with hazardous waste securely.
